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4113833743 15330203517 37752 036 051
898 1044 751244378
898 1044 751244378
28486 0581 29462
All about undefined
Interested in learning more?
898 1044 751244378
28486 0581 29462
See more
1875 465
0697603348 382709 614 486324162
See more
135490 44270 748814531
5990212880 1469 28272 85300765 0257
See more